Dr. Dmitriy Fuzaylov is a dually board-certified physiatrist and interventional pain management physician who cares for patients in Rego Park, Queens and Malverne, Long Island. His clinical focus is the non-surgical diagnosis and treatment of spine and joint conditions — with two core objectives: relieving pain and restoring each patient's capacity to live and move fully.
Dr. Fuzaylov earned his medical degree from Mount Sinai School of Medicine and completed his residency in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ation at Columbia/New York-Presbyterian Hospital, where he trained across four of the nation's most respected medical institutions — Columbia Presbyterian, Weill Cornell Medical Center, Hospital for Special Surgery, and Memorial Sloan Kettering Cancer Center. He then pursued a fellowship in Pain Medicine at Penn State Hershey Medical Center. An active contributor to his field, Dr. Fuzaylov has presented at national medical conferences and published research in peer-reviewed journals within his specialty.

Interventional & Regenerative
Dr. Fuzaylov provides a comprehensive suite of evidence-based, minimally invasive procedures — each selected and tailored to the individual patient's diagnosis, anatomy, and recovery goals.
Injection-based regenerative therapy that stimulates the body's natural healing response in damaged ligaments and tendons.
Concentrated growth factors derived from the patient's own blood, used to accelerate tissue repair and reduce inflammation.
Targeted delivery of anti-inflammatory medication into the epidural space to relieve nerve-related spinal pain.
Precision injections that diagnose and treat pain originating from the small stabilizing joints of the spine.
Diagnostic and therapeutic injections for pain caused by dysfunction of the SI joint connecting the spine to the pelvis.
Image-guided lubricant injections for knee osteoarthritis, improving joint mobility and reducing pain with precision placement.
